The Influence of Sports in Today's Multi Cultural Groups
Start date: May 1, 2012,

The project's main aim was to show-case how informal education can bring together people of different cultural backgrounds through the use of sports and outdoor activities. The central activity was a live-in youth camp with the theme "The Influence of Sports in Today's Multicultural Groups". This was held in Malta, the host country. The participants were young members of Malta Karate Federation, Centro Studi Karate Shotokan (Italy) and Polish Karate Federation. A Facebook group was used by the youths to discuss plans before the live-in and share experiences after. During the training camp the participants took part in team-building activities, karate training and discussions about various relevant themes, such as "Social inclusion through sports", "The white paper on sports" and "Active aging and lifelong employability". The results of the discussions were documented in a booklet, while the activities were recorded in a short video.
